Villa Olivia Country Club and Ski Area
       
 
Villa Olivia Country Club and Ski Area Your club for all seasons...and reasons!
 
   
Description   Ski Chicagoland's highest mountain and ski Chicagoland's only qaud chairlift. The programs are for three sessions of 1-1/2 hours each. Beginner, intermediate and advanced lessons packages are available for ages ten and up. Snowboard, downhill ski and cross-country ski equipment are available for rental. Our newest amenity is snowtubing. Snow tubes and a lift that pulls you up the hill are included in the daily fee.

  We offer an 18 hole golf course, a banquet facility for weddings, meetings and holiday parties, a tent for company picnics and golf outings with bocce, swimming pool, horse shoes and volleyball.

Did you know:
 
  What do you do when local religious leaders deem ice cream sodas too impious for sale on Sunday? You serve ice cream and syrup without the soda. And when they object to the name “sunday,” you change it to “sundae.” That’s how the ice cream sundae was born in Evanston.
